For a long time, I thought finding the right relationship would make my life feel complete.
Now, I'm realizing that's not the goal.
Before my next relationship, there are things I want for myself—not because they'll make me more "worthy" of love, but because they'll make my life fuller, richer, and more fulfilling regardless of whether I'm single or not.
In this episode, I talk about becoming my own person again, building confidence that doesn't depend on someone else's attention, strengthening friendships, pursuing my own goals, and creating a life I genuinely love living.
I also share two Reddit stories that sparked an important question:
What if the best thing you can bring into your next relationship... is a life you've already fallen in love with?
